But I've done my own research (so there) and I think he's based on Earnest Altounyan. Bob Blackett had to be a suitable partner for the wonderful Mrs Blackett and he had to be supportive of, if not highly influential on, his two harum-scarums.And I think he doesn't appear because AR had to kill him off cause Captain Flint needed to be the dominant male adult (I've been reading A LOT about AR). Notice that Ted Walker is kept mostly out of the way, but it was OK to have two mothers who were friends. If my cunning theory is right then it also presages the falling out AR and Earnest Altounyan had later. I've never forgotten the scene on top of Kanchenjunga. Most authors wouldn't account for a missing parent in such an honest way.
